Why Slow Hiring Is More Expensive Than Most Companies Realize
Many organizations calculate recruitment costs based only on advertising expenses or recruiter salaries.
The real cost is much larger.
Every unfilled role creates hidden business losses that accumulate daily.
| Recruitment Delay | Business Impact |
|---|---|
| Longer Time-to-Hire | Lost productivity |
| Delayed Projects | Missed revenue opportunities |
| Candidate Drop-offs | Strong talent joins competitors |
| Recruiter Workload | Higher operational costs |
| Poor Candidate Experience | Employer brand suffers |
Research consistently shows that skilled candidates often remain available for only a short period before accepting another offer.
That means every unnecessary approval step, manual screening process, or delayed communication increases the likelihood of losing your preferred candidate.
The companies winning today's talent market aren't necessarily offering the highest salaries.
They're offering the fastest, most organized hiring experience.

Five Recruitment Trends Every HR Leader Should Watch
1. Candidate Experience Matters More Than Ever
Candidates judge employers by their hiring process.
Fast communication creates trust.
Delayed communication creates uncertainty.
2. Mobile Recruitment Continues to Grow
Most job seekers now search for opportunities using smartphones.
Platforms optimized for mobile applications receive stronger engagement.
3. AI Improves Recruiter Efficiency
The focus has shifted from replacing recruiters to helping recruiters make faster, better decisions.
4. Skills-Based Hiring Is Expanding
Organizations increasingly evaluate practical skills alongside degrees and experience.
This widens access to qualified talent.
5. Recruitment Analytics Are Becoming Essential
Leading HR teams monitor:
- Time-to-hire
- Cost-per-hire
- Offer acceptance rate
- Source effectiveness
- Candidate conversion rates
Better data produces better hiring decisions.
